IELTS Fee Structure in Pakistan (2026 )
As of 2026, prospects in Pakistan ought to anticipate modifications in the Ielts Pakistan Fees fee structure that may arise from inflation and other economic elements. Below is an introduction of the anticipated fees associated with the IELTS test:
Test TypeEstimated Fee (PKR)DetailsIELTS Academic35,000For individuals seeking greater educationIELTS General Training35,000For those planning to immigrate or work abroadIELTS for UKVI45,000For UK visa applicationsIelts Online Registration Pakistan Life Skills30,000For those making an application for household visas to the UKExtra Costs
In addition to the exam fees, prospects may incur costs for different optional services that can boost their IELTS experience. These may include:
Optional ServiceEstimated Fee (PKR)DetailsRescheduling Fee5,000Relevant if a prospect needs to alter their test dateExtra Score Report3,000For each additional copy of the test results sent to institutionsTest Preparation Course15,000 - 30,000Varies based upon the institution supplying the courseIELTS Practice Materials2,000 - 4,500Official guidebooks and practice testsIELTS Test Centers in Pakistan

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)Q1: What is the validity of IELTS ratings in Pakistan?
A1: Ielts Pakistan Fee 2026 ratings are legitimate for 2 years from the test date, after which a prospect needs to retake the exam to revalidate their efficiency.
Q2: Can I pay the IELTS fees online in Pakistan?
A2: Yes, the majority of test centers in Pakistan provide online payment options for benefit.
Q3: How soon can I retake the IELTS exam?
A3: Candidates can retake the IELTS exam as quickly as they are prepared, without any compulsory waiting period.
Q4: Are there any discounts offered for multiple test registrations?
A4: Currently, there are no commonly recognized discounts, but prospects ought to consult their regional test center for possible deals.
Q5: What identification is needed for the IELTS exam?
A5: A government-issued ID, such as a nationwide identity card or passport, is essential to register and take the test.
